Kelimpahan Zooplankton Dalam Kolam Gambut Ikan Patin (Pangasius Hypophthalmus) Yang Diberi Campuran Biofertilizer Feses Manusia Dan Sapi
The research was carried out in October to November 2019, located on the Peatlands
in the Pine Farmers Road, Kualu Nenas Village, Tambang District, Kampar Regency, Riau
Province. Observation of zooplankton have been done in the Laboratory of Environment
Quality of Aquaqulture, Biology Chemistry Laboratory, Fisheries and Marine Faculty. The
purpose of this study was to determine the effect of a mixture of human feces biofertilizer
with cow feces that is best for increasing zooplankton abundance, growth and survival of
catfish (Pangasius sp) in peat ponds. The research method is an experimental method, using a
completely randomized design (CRD) of one factor (a mixture of human feces biofertilizer
and cow feces biofertilizer), 5 (five) levels of treatment, were P0: (control); P1 (Giving
biofertilizer 20% human feces + 80% cow feces); P2 (Giving biofertilizer 40% human feces
+ 60% cow feces); P3 (Giving biofertilizer 60% human feces + 40% cow feces); P4 (Giving
80% human feces + 20% cow feces), 3 (three) replications. The results of this study that was
P4 (Giving 80% human feces + 20% cow feces) to produce zooplankton abundance (8889 ind
/ l), absolute weight growth (17.3 g), absolute length growth (4.4 cm) and survival of catfish
(86%) compared to (P3, P2, P1 and P0). The water quality during the study was quite good,
temperature 26-29oC, pH 6-7, DO 5-6 mg / l, Nitrate 3.77 ppm, Orthoposphate 4.51 ppm.
Keywords: Biofertilizer, zooplankton abundance, peat soil, Pangasius sp
